powerpc: rename arch_irq_disabled_regs
Rename arch_irq_disabled_regs() to regs_irqs_disabled() to align with the naming used in the generic irqentry framework. This makes the function available for use both in the PowerPC architecture code and in the common entry/exit paths shared with other architectures. This is a preparatory change for enabling the generic irqentry framework on PowerPC.
